This Professional Certificate in Green Chemistry for Community Leaders is designed for beginners seeking to understand and implement sustainable practices. The program focuses on building a foundational knowledge of green chemistry principles and their practical applications within community contexts.
Learning outcomes include a comprehensive understanding of the twelve principles of green chemistry, the ability to assess the environmental impact of chemical processes, and the skills to promote sustainable alternatives within a community setting. Participants will gain experience in evaluating life cycle assessments and develop strategies for implementing greener solutions. This includes exposure to eco-friendly materials and technologies.

A Professional Certificate in Green Chemistry is increasingly significant for community leaders in the UK, given the nation's commitment to environmental sustainability. The UK government aims for Net Zero by 2050, driving demand for professionals skilled in sustainable practices. According to recent reports, the green economy in the UK is booming, with thousands of new jobs created annually. This surge highlights a crucial need for community leaders equipped with green chemistry expertise to guide sustainable development initiatives within their communities.
Understanding green chemistry principles – encompassing waste reduction, energy efficiency, and the use of safer chemicals – is paramount for effective policy-making and community engagement. A certificate provides the necessary knowledge to assess environmental impacts, advocate for sustainable practices, and implement environmentally sound projects. This expertise equips community leaders to address local challenges like pollution control and resource management, contributing to the national commitment to a greener future.
